Understanding Wagering Requirements and Bonus Structures
Wagering requirements are the cornerstone of any casino bonus. They represent the multiple of the bonus amount (or bonus amount plus deposit) that you must wager before withdrawing funds. For example, a bonus with a 30x wagering requirement means that if you receive a $100 bonus, you need to wager $3000 before you can cash out. These requirements can vary significantly between casinos and bonus types, so diligent research is essential. Different game types also contribute differently to meeting these requirements. Slots typically contribute 100%, while table games like blackjack or roulette might only contribute 10% or 20%. Understanding these nuances allows you to strategically select games that help you fulfill the wagering requirements efficiently.
The Impact of Game Contribution Percentages
The contribution percentages significantly affect how quickly you can clear a bonus. If you prefer playing table games, a bonus with a low contribution percentage will take considerably longer to unlock than one where slots contribute fully. Consider your preferred games when evaluating a bonus. Don't simply focus on the headline bonus amount; assess the overall value based on your playing habits. Some casinos offer specialized bonuses for specific game categories, such as live dealer games, which may have more favorable wagering requirements for those who enjoy that experience. Always read the bonus terms carefully to determine which games are eligible and their respective contribution percentages.
| Game Type | Typical Wagering Contribution |
|---|---|
| Slots | 100% |
| Blackjack | 10-20% |
| Roulette | 10-20% |
| Video Poker | 5-10% |
| Live Dealer Games | 10-30% |
This table illustrates the typical contribution percentages for common casino games. It's crucial to remember that these percentages can vary between casinos, so always verify the specific terms of the bonus offer. Strategic game selection, based on these contribution percentages, can optimize your bonus clearing process. Choosing games with higher contributions allows you to reduce the total amount you need to wager, speeding up the pathway to withdrawing your winnings.
Maximizing Bonus Value Through Strategic Play
Beyond understanding wagering requirements, strategic play is essential for maximizing bonus value. This involves carefully choosing games with favorable odds, managing your bankroll effectively, and leveraging bonus opportunities to extend your playtime. A common strategy is to focus on games with a high Return to Player (RTP) percentage. RTP represents the theoretical percentage of all wagered money that a game will pay back to players over time. Generally, games with higher RTP percentages offer better long-term odds. It's also important to practice responsible bankroll management by setting a budget and sticking to it, regardless of whether you're playing with bonus funds or your own money. This ensures you avoid overspending and maintain control over your finances.
Exploring Different Bonus Types and Their Advantages
Casinos offer a variety of bonus types, each with its own unique advantages and disadvantages. These include welcome bonuses, deposit bonuses, no-deposit bonuses, free spins, and cashback offers. Welcome bonuses are typically the largest, offered to new players upon signing up. Deposit bonuses require you to make a deposit to qualify, often matching a percentage of your deposit amount. No-deposit bonuses are particularly attractive, as they allow you to play without risking any of your own money. Free spins are awarded for specific slot games, offering you the chance to win without wagering any of your own funds. Cashback offers provide a percentage of your losses back to you, mitigating some of the risk involved in gambling. Each type suits different player preferences and strategies.
- Welcome Bonuses: Typically the most generous, targeting new players.
- Deposit Bonuses: Require a deposit, offering a percentage match.
- No-Deposit Bonuses: Allow play without initial funding, often with restrictions.
- Free Spins: Limited to specific slot games, providing free chances to win.
- Cashback Offers: Return a percentage of losses, reducing risk.
Understanding the specific terms and conditions of each bonus type is critical. For example, no-deposit bonuses often come with higher wagering requirements and maximum withdrawal limits. The Importance of Responsible Gaming and Setting Limits
While casino bonuses can enhance your gaming experience, it’s crucial to prioritize responsible gambling. This involves setting limits on your deposits, wagers, and playtime, and recognizing the signs of problem gambling. Chasing losses is a dangerous trap that can quickly lead to financial difficulties. It’s important to view casino games as a form of entertainment, not a source of income. Utilize the tools offered by many online casinos to manage your gambling behavior, such as deposit limits, loss limits, and self-exclusion options. These tools can help you stay within your budget and prevent impulsive decisions. Remember, the goal is to enjoy the excitement of casino gaming responsibly and sustainably.
Recognizing and Addressing Problem Gambling
Problem gambling can manifest in various ways, including spending more than you can afford to lose, neglecting personal responsibilities, and lying to others about your gambling habits. If you or someone you know is struggling with problem gambling, it's essential to seek help. Numerous resources are available, including helplines, support groups, and counseling services. Don’t hesitate to reach out for assistance. Early intervention can significantly improve the chances of overcoming a gambling addiction. Many casinos also offer self-assessment tools to help you evaluate your gambling behavior and identify potential issues. Remember, seeking help is a sign of strength, not weakness.
- Set a Budget: Decide how much you're willing to spend and stick to it.
- Time Limits: Limit your playtime to avoid getting carried away.
- Avoid Chasing Losses: Don't try to win back lost money by increasing your bets.
- Use Available Tools: Utilize deposit limits, loss limits, and self-exclusion options.
- Seek Help if Needed: Don't hesitate to reach out for support if you're struggling.
Implementing these steps can foster a healthier relationship with casino gaming and prevent potential harm. Remember, responsible gaming is not about eliminating enjoyment; it’s about ensuring that your gambling remains a fun and sustainable activity.
Beyond the Bonus: Exploring Loyalty Programs and VIP Rewards
Many online casinos offer loyalty programs and VIP rewards as a way to retain players. These programs typically award points for every wager you make, which can be redeemed for bonus funds, free spins, or other perks. VIP programs typically offer even more exclusive benefits, such as dedicated account managers, faster withdrawals, and invitations to special events. Actively participating in these programs can significantly enhance your overall casino experience and provide additional value over time. The accumulation of loyalty points can translate into substantial rewards, effectively boosting your bankroll and extending your playtime. Understanding the tiers and benefits of each program allows you to maximize your rewards and enjoy a more personalized gaming experience.
These programs provide a sustained benefit, unlike one-time bonuses, encouraging continued engagement and investment in the casino platform. They often require consistent play to climb the tiers, incentivizing players to remain loyal to the platform. Investigating the rewards structure and eligibility requirements of loyalty programs can unlock a continuous stream of benefits, adding another layer of value to your casino journey.
